Ultra-Processed Foods (UPFs): Eating Yourself Sick
What are UPFs according to the classification?
NOVA Classification
Most research uses the NOVA classification, which groups foods by the purpose and extent of processing, not just nutrients. In NOVA, UPFs are Group 4: industrially manufactured products made from combinations of refined ingredients (starches, sugars, oils, protein isolates) plus additives, with little (or no) intact whole food remaining.

Black lentil and beet salad, a celebration of color and iron
Black lentils are rich in iron, protein, dietary fiber and antioxidants- excellent for balancing sugar, cholesterol and digestive health. Beets are known for their ability to improve blood circulation, reduce blood pressure and increase natural energy thanks to their nitrate content.
